Radford, Va. - Nippon Pulse America’s new SCR100 stage is an ultra high precision, compact single axis stage that integrates a slide guide, encoder, and Linear Shaft Motor. It offers a wide range of advantages for ultra high performance and accuracy applications. The Linear Shaft Motor is a coreless direct drive linear motor which has zero cogging, allowing for higher resolution, speed, and continuous force than standard stepper motors and piezo servomotors. 
The SCR100 stage is a moving magnet design, which locates all cables and connectors in the stationary base. The absence of any moving cable means a clean and compact design and eliminates motion errors due to cable forces. The precision ground cross roller way provides high stiffness and smooth motion. Together they are capable of supporting higher torque levels due to offset loads with travels from 50mm to 300mm. The non-contact Linear Shaft Motor and optical linear encoders are self-contained inside the stage, making it a low-profile compact solution. The built-in non-contact optical linear encoder is available with resolutions from 1 micron to 10 nm with digital output. The sub-micron resolution results in a high accuracy stage, which is laser tested for optimum performance.
The SCR100 stage has the added benefit that any standard digital servo driver can drive the SCR100 stage. Any two SCR stages will bolt directly together to form a very stiff, compact X-Y stage. Two SCR stages can be supplied compounded as an X-Y stage to insure true orthogonal orientation.

Heason Technology (http://www.heason.com) has introduced an all-new high throughput version of the Mini-MAG linear motor driven positioning stage from distribution partner Dover Inc. (www.dovercorporation.com).
While the new, ultra-compact MMG-AL still incorporates the main design and dimensional characteristics of the range, it replaces the stainless steel base and top plate with an optional single phase linear motor and simplified high grade aluminum construction. When combined, this results in minimized moving mass with the added benefit of lowered stage and drive amplifier costs, as well as higher bandwidth performance.
The small footprint stage comes in four travel options from 25mm to 150mm. It has a nominal width of 80mm and features Dover’s MAG moving magnet motor technology, which does away with the need for moving motor cables. It also features a durable side mounted tape style optical encoder, which comes in a selection of positional resolution from 0.1 microns to 0.005 microns. With stage flatness and straightness across the new MMG-AL range from 4 microns to 8 microns, and with specified bidirectional repeatability to within +/- 0.5 microns, the 25mm travel version’s positional accuracy is 3 microns with a 0.1 micron encoder.
The MMG-AL range has less than two-thirds of the mass of its stainless steel counterpart and 8kg nominal load capacity with an optional higher load capacity. The positioning stage can meet the dynamic performance needed for the most demanding high precision production systems, thanks to its maximum acceleration of 22m/sec2 and velocity of 0.5msec. The stage caters to the need of high throughput imaging industries, as well as ideal for any precision position application, where in-position stability and step-and-settle times are the main requirements.

Sunnyvale, Calif. – Equipment Solutions’ VCS-2020 Voice Coil Stage features a 20 mm diameter aperture, 20 mm (0.7874 in.) travel, and sub-micron (1.1811 10-6 in.) positioning resolution. An integrated Analog position feedback sensor assures 100 nanometer (3.937 10-6 in.) repeatability. The cross-roller voice-coil stages are self contained, compact, and can be mounted in a horizontal or vertical axis. 
The compact 117 x 75 x 81 mm (4.60 x 2.96 x 3.18 in.), low mass, voice coil stage is a fully self-contained system including a high precision cross roller stage, voice coil actuator, analog position sensor, servo amplifier and servo controller. The low-inertia cross roller stage is integral to the standard threaded “C” lens mount and motor coil for tip/tilt free motion. Custom lens mounts are available. The voice coil motor is rated at 17.8 N (4 lbs.) continuous force and 71.8 N (16 lbs.) peak for 10 seconds and is cleanroom compatible. For easy integration into a new or existing application, the VCS-10H Voice Coil Stage has multiple sets of mounting holes on several surfaces.
This compact voice coil stage is ideal for such micro-positioning applications as scanning interferometry, disk drive testing, auto focus systems, surface structure analysis, confocal microscopy, biotechnology, and semiconductor test equipment.

Irvine, CA - Newport Corporation announces the UMR-TRA XY Stages. The new line of integrated XY stages are built from reliable, industry-standard UMR linear stages and TRA actuators. Affordable and compact, the small footprint measures only 90 mm wide and 38 mm high, including the base plate. The UMR-TRA-XY stages are specially designed for applications in confined spaces, making them an excellent choice for a wide range of motion control tasks in research and industry.

The UMR-TRA has 12.5mm travel and is available in English or metric versions, DC or stepper motor, and a vacuum-compatible stepper-motor version which is compatible down to 10-6 hPa. For research, the stage is ideal for use in vacuum applications and other space-restricted setups. For industrial applications, the robust stage is qualified for laser beam positioning and can withstand high machine accelerations. The UMR-TRA is compatible with all of Newport’s popular motion controllers, from the hand-held NewStep™ single-axis stepper-motor controller, to the sophisticated and high performance XPS universal controller.

Schaumburg, IL – Misumi USA, Inc. introduces a new series of Standard Precision Positioning Stages to complement its existing line of High Precision Positioning Stages. The new stages feature a simplified product design that make them suitable and very cost-effective for applications in which frequent and/or fine adjustment is needed, but ultra-high precision is not required.

Misumi’s new series of Standard Precision Stages are designed to deliver optimal adjustment flexibility, with acceptable and repeatable precision levels in positioning devices for automated inspection, assembly, and machining, as well as for processing instruments (e.g., welders) and production jigs. By streamlining functionality and precision levels (relative to straightness, pitching, yawing and rolling), Misumi is able to offer the new models at a price point 20 to 35 percent lower than pricing for its ultra-precise High Precision Stages. Order fulfillment time is also shorter – the new series takes just three days to ship versus six days for High Precision models.
The Standard Precision Positioning Stages series is comprised of three different versions and a total of 22 models. These include:
• Cross-Roller Stages (Part Number XCRS). Available in 9 different models – 3 sizes each in X-Axis, XY-Axis, and Z-Axis versions – these cross-roller guides incorporate two rollers connecting upper and lower plate, resulting in accurate and reliable positioning.
• Dovetail Stages (Rack & Pinion, Part Number XDTS). Available in 9 different models – 3 sizes each in X-Axis, XY-Axis, and Z-Axis versions – this slide mechanism consists of two precision-ground flat surfaces sliding against each other. (Note: Due to direct contact between upper and lower aluminum alloy plates, this stage is not suited for high moment load.)
• Long-Travel Dovetail Stages (Rack & Pinion, Part Number XDTLS). Available in 4 different models – 2 sizes each in X-Axis and Z-Axis – this slide mechanism extends the travel distance of the Dovetail Stage.
All three versions have top and bottom surface plates made of Aluminum Alloy with a Black Anodized surface treatment.

Greenville, DE – Servo2Go has just added a new high performance linear stage series to its broad range of positioning systems.

Manufactured by Zaber Technologies Inc., the T-LSM series devices are computer-controlled motorized linear stages with high thrust and speed capabilities and a very compact size. They are stand-alone units requiring only a standard 15V power supply. A potentiometer knob at the end of the unit permits smooth manual control; turn it fully to get maximum speed. These slides connect to the RS-232 port of any computer and can be daisy-chained with up to 254 units per chain. They can also be chained with any other T-Series products. Convenient 6-pin mini din cables on the unit allow for direct interconnection between units in close proximity. For longer distances, a standard cable extension can be used.

BURLINGTON, MA — Steinmeyer, Inc. announced a new precision linear stage, the PA 30×40-SM01. This single axis system is ideal wherever there is a need for an extremely narrow positioning table. Typical uses include miniature robotics, pick and place devices, specimen handling for life sciences and scientific applications where precision positioning is required within a very narrow foot print. This compact, fully enclosed stage is only 30 mm wide and 40 mm high. Available travels range from 25 mm to 150 mm. Positioning repeatability is 1 micron, maximum speed is 50 mm/s and load capacity is 100 newton.

Included inside this precision assembly are a precision preloaded 8 mm diameter Steinmeyer ball screw, miniature size 9 linear guideway, non-contact limit switches and a choice of either stepper motor or DC servo motor with encoder. A separate motion controller is available as an option.
